5 Beautiful Malaysia Island You Must Visit in 2019 for a Perfect Trip

Malaysia is home to many archipelagos and has more than 800 islands, many of which remain uninhabited. However there are many islands that have become very popular tourist destinations over the years. 1. Redang Island – this stunning island getaway is found in the Kuala Nerus District of Terengganu. It is one of the largest islands and is famous for its beautiful white sand beaches and magnificent crystal clear waters. The coastline of Redang island covered with jungle that drop directly into the ocean that provide good conditions for coral reef formation, thus making the  island a very popular for those of you who would enjoy snorkeling and diving.

2.Tioman Island – the beautiful Tioman Island is located in Pahang. It has 7 villages and is covered in dense forest. The surrounding waters are home to stunning coral reefs that make this a popular destination for those who love to scuba dive, snorkel and even for surfers. In the 1970s, TIME Magazine named Tioman Islands as one of the world’s most beautiful islands and it truly does live up to its accolades.  The island is also home to a diverse marine life and many protected animal species including the binturong, the long-tailed macaque and the red giant flying squirrel to name a few can be found in its dense rainforest  The Tioman Island provides visitors with a tropical jungle getaway.  3. Pangkor Island is a captivating resort island located in  Perak. The island is home to many stunning beaches and has plenty of locations and sites to explore. Some of the attractions that you must explore are the the tombs in Kampung Teluk Gedung, Tortoise Hill, the Fu Ling Kong temple and the Dutch Fort (Kota Belanda). For those of you who aren’t huge fans of the ocean, there is plenty of fun to have on land with a fascinating uphill trek from which you can experience stunning views of the island and see plenty of local wildlife – there are also jungle trails that nature lovers can enjoy. If you get a chance you can also hail one of the pink taxis that this island has become famous for. 4. Langkawi Island is an archipelago of over 100 islands that is aptly known as the Jewel of Kedah. These beautiful islands are largely uninhabited but the main Langkawi island has become a popular tourist destination for honeymooners, surfers, scuba divers and anyone who would enjoy a tropical island getaway. The main island is surrounded by stunning waters and is renowned for its diving opportunities. Visitors to Langkawi have a diverse range of activities that they can enjoy. Island-hopping covers the islands around the mainland which are famous for their thick rainforest, limestone caves and freely roaming wildlife.  The island is also famous for its beautiful white sandy beaches and resorts that provide a variety of watersport activities. Although there are not many waterfalls in the island, they are an impressive sight to see – the Telaga Tujuh Waterfall is also known as the home of the fairies and the Seven Wells Waterfalls is named because of the 7 connected pools fed by it. 5. Sipadan island located in Sabah is the only oceanic island  of the many islands found in Malaysia. The magnificent isle was formed on top of an extinct volcanic cone by living corals. The island is situated at the heart of the Indo-Pacific basin which is the epicenter of one of the richest marine habitats in the world. Sipadan is home to more than 400 species of fish and hundreds of coral species. The stunning marine life makes this a heaven for scuba divers and snorkelers that has seen the island receive many accolades such as “Top Dive Destination in the World”.
